Landen and Kimberly have been together for almost 12 years and married for six. They began trying for Baby Cavin in August of 2019 and spent several years trying to conceive naturally, leaning on faith and hope through each season. In the summer of 2022, they sought guidance through a local fertility clinic, praying for clarity and direction.

Their fertility journey began with Ovulation Induction (OI). The first cycle brought joyful news with a positive pregnancy test, followed by the heartbreak of an early loss. Even in that grief, they held onto hope and continued with two additional OI cycles without success.

Next, they moved forward with Intrauterine Insemination (IUI). Once again, the first attempt brought hope with another positive test, but it too ended in an early loss. After two more IUI cycles, they became pregnant again and reached eight weeks—the furthest they had ever come—before experiencing another heartbreaking miscarriage. Kimberly later required a D&C when her body was unable to complete the miscarriage on its own.

After so much loss, IVF was recommended as their best path forward. While IVF offered hope, it also brought emotional and financial challenges. With the help of a local grant through their fertility clinic, Kimberly and Landen were able to begin the IVF process and were blessed with four embryos, now frozen and waiting. Unfortunately, they were unable to continue to the transfer stage due to the cost.

During the egg retrieval process, despite being on birth control, Kimberly became pregnant once more, but this pregnancy also ended very early. Due to the financial strain, they made the difficult decision to pause fertility treatments earlier in 2025, even though they still have embryos waiting.

During the pause, in March of 2025, Kimberly became pregnant naturally for the first time. What began with renewed hope quickly became a life-threatening emergency. The pregnancy was ectopic and located in her right fallopian tube. Kimberly lost her tube and nearly lost her life. This experience brought on unexpected medical and surgical expenses, adding further financial strain during an already difficult season. Through it all, they are deeply grateful for God’s protection and the support that carried them through.

Since beginning fertility treatments, Kimberly and Landen have experienced:

3 OI cycles
3 IUI cycles
IVF resulting in 4 frozen embryos
5 pregnancy losses, including a life-threatening ectopic pregnancy
